
Bobcats Announce Tender
April 14, 2008 - North American Hockey League (NAHL)
Bismarck Bobcats News Release
The Bismarck Bobcats have tendered 5'11" 180 lb. defenseman, John Avino. You may remember him in a 'Cats uniform, as he had a short stint in the Den over Christmas. He also has experience from playing with the 2006-2007 Dubuque Thunderbirds of the CSHL, where he netted 2 goals and tallied 6 helpers for a total of 8 points. He hails from Mount Prospect, IL and was born in 1989.
"John is a steady defenseman who takes care of his own end first," stated Bobcats head coach Byron Pool. "He competes about as hard as any player I have seen this year and comes from a strong program in Dubuque in which he was a big part. I expect John to be able to step in and play a similar role with our program next year."
